Forum: Multimedia
Delphi
by PeterPanino,
15. Nov 2009
Wenn ich das Bild wiederholt als JPG abspeichere, treten KEINE Farbfehler auf:
1. Speichern als bild1.JPG wie oben im Beispiel-Code: Keine Farbfehler
2. Speichern als bild2.JPG wie oben im Beispiel-Code: Keine Farbfehler
3. Speichern als bild3.JPG wie oben im Beispiel-Code: Keine Farbfehler
4. Speichern als bild4.JPG wie oben im Beispiel-Code: Keine Farbfehler
5. Speichern als bild5.JPG...
Forum: Multimedia
Delphi
by PeterPanino,
15. Nov 2009
Hallo Luckie,
ich verwende nur den obigen Code, keine Kompression.
Forum: Multimedia
Delphi
by PeterPanino,
15. Nov 2009
Hallo,
wenn ich mit Jpeg.SaveToFile ein Bild speichere, treten beim gespeicherten Bild massive Farbfehler (Falschfarben) auf, wenn die Farbtiefe in Windows auf 16 Bit eingestellt ist. Wenn die Windows-Farbtiefe auf 32 Bit eingestellt ist, treten diese Farbfehler nicht auf:
Jpeg := TJpegImage.Create();
try
Jpeg.Assign(MyImage.Picture.Bitmap);
//Jpeg.PixelFormat := jf8Bit; //...